Choosing the Right Technology Partner for Digital Transformation

Embarking on a digital transformation journey—whether that involves deploying a fleet of native Android apps, building a PostgreSQL cloud database, or outfitting a secure computer lab—is not a one-time purchase. It is a long-term strategic initiative. The most critical decision a business owner makes is not which software to buy, but which technology partner to trust.

Look for Full-Stack Capabilities

Many agencies specialize in only one thing. They might build beautiful websites but have no idea how to configure an Annual Maintenance Contract (AMC) for your physical hardware. True digital transformation requires a partner that understands the entire ecosystem: from the physical biometric scanners on your office wall to the advanced Kotlin code powering your mobile apps.

The Importance of Business Logic

A great technology partner does not just write code; they understand business. When interviewing an agency, they should ask deep, operational questions. How does your supply chain work? What are the bottlenecks in your payroll? The software they propose should be custom-engineered to solve those exact human problems, not just to show off technical jargon.

Commitment to Post-Launch Maintenance

Never partner with a "launch-and-leave" agency. The true value of a software development company is proven after deployment. A reliable partner will offer comprehensive post-launch software maintenance, continuous cybersecurity audits, and scalable cloud hosting management to ensure your digital assets grow alongside your revenue.
